    Mechanical properties of electroless copper deposits considered to be most important for printed circuit manufacturing process. In order to achieve sufficient performance level, the correlation between the mechanical properties and basic bath formulation and condition of electroless copper were studied.
    Ductility was increased with increasing copper ion, formaldehyde concentration and pH value at certain level of dissolved oxygen. However, ductility was not fully correlated with occurence of corner cracking after soldering. The differences in mechanical properties of copper were caused by the differences of crystal structure and incorporated impurities and hydrogen. It was also found that high elongation copper has 1000-1800Å in grain size and low one has 700-800Å in grain size.

    Recently the crosstalk noise has come into problem according to high-density wiring of the printed circuit board. The reduction technique of the crosstalk noise by means of diode termination was described in this report.
    The measurements were qualitatively confirmed by the simulation using partial element equivalent circuit model and circuit simulator. The reduction of undershoot of the wave fall-off caused by the reflection depends on the junction capacitance of the diode.
    The crosstalk noise was reduced 1/3-1/2 by the termination of the active line only. The effects are the trade-off between fall-time and noise reduction.
